What “App-Controlled” and “Automatic” Actually Mean

These two terms get used interchangeably in marketing but they’re different features.

Automatic means the device produces motion on its own — thrusting, sucking, stroking — via a built-in motor. You don’t move it, it moves on you. Hands-free use is the defining feature. Most automatic strokers also have manual controls (buttons on the device for pattern and speed selection) so you don’t need an app.

App-controlled means the device pairs with a smartphone app via Bluetooth. The app adds: pattern customisation, voice control, music-sync, long-distance partner control (over internet), and content-syncing (the device follows the motion of adult content you’re watching). Most premium devices are both automatic and app-controlled.

AI-synced / interactive means the device responds to either live content (a cam performer’s movements), pre-encoded content (videos with motion data embedded), or AI-generated motion based on analysis of standard video. Kiiroo’s FeelMe AI is the leading example.

The Kiiroo Ecosystem

Kiiroo is a Dutch brand founded in 2013, now the global leader in interactive male sex tech. Their ecosystem is built around the Keon as the central device with modular accessories.

Kiiroo Keon

The flagship automatic stroker. Holds an interchangeable FeelStroker sleeve (sold separately, with options molded from named adult performers — Agatha Vega, Victoria June, FeelLacy and many others). Strokes at up to 230 strokes per minute with adjustable length. Pairs via Bluetooth with FeelConnect for app control, content syncing and long-distance use.

Build quality is genuinely premium — the matte-black plastic shell, the precise mechanics, the included case. Battery runs ~2 hours per charge. Charge time is 4 hours.

The Keon is the premium gold standard for hands-free male strokers in 2026.

Kiiroo PowerBlow

2024 suction accessory that attaches to compatible FeelStroker sleeves. Adds pulsing suction during use — effectively combining stroking (from the Keon body) with suction (from the PowerBlow). Manual modes via buttons or full control via FeelConnect app.

When paired with a Keon, the combined effect simulates oral plus thrusting motion — the closest a current device gets to “hands-free blowjob simulation”.

Kiiroo PowerShot (2026 launch)

Newer compact stroker, released early 2026. Smaller form factor than the Keon, dual-motor vibration, full FeelConnect and FeelMe AI integration. Targets users who want the Kiiroo ecosystem without the size or price of the full Keon.

FeelMe AI

Kiiroo’s AI motion-syncing service. Connects to compatible video content (pre-encoded interactive videos, or standard videos with AI-generated motion analysis) and drives the connected Kiiroo device to match. Significantly elevates the interactive experience over manual mode — the device responds to what you’re watching, not what you’re telling it.

FeelConnect app

The control hub for the Kiiroo ecosystem. Manual mode (real-time control via on-screen sliders), automatic mode (preset patterns), music-sync (vibration patterns matched to audio), long-distance mode (paired partner control over internet), and content-sync (Kiiroo or third-party encoded video).

The Lovense Ecosystem

Lovense is a Hong Kong-based brand widely known for clitoral and partner toys (Lush, Domi). Their male product line has expanded significantly since 2022.

Lovense Solace Pro

Automatic thrusting stroker, released 2024. Adjustable thrust length and speed, longer battery runtime than the Kiiroo Keon (typically 4 hours vs 2 hours). Built-in screen for direct device control without phone needed. Pairs with the Lovense Remote app for partner / pattern / music-sync use.

Where Solace Pro wins over Keon: battery life and standalone usability. Where Keon wins over Solace Pro: sleeve options (Kiiroo’s FeelStroker range is more extensive) and AI content sync (FeelMe AI is more mature).

Lovense Calor

Heated app-controlled stroker. The heating element brings the sleeve to body temperature — a meaningful realism upgrade. App-paired for pattern control and long-distance use. Not a full thrusting auto-stroker; you hand-hold it but with internal vibration and heat.

If “heated” is your priority feature: Calor is the dedicated product for it.

Lovense Gush

Wearable male vibrator — a vibrating glans-focused toy you strap onto the head of the penis. Not a stroker; works during partnered sex (vibrates against both you and your partner) or solo. App-paired, long-distance compatible.

Lovense Max 2

Hand-held interactive sleeve with internal vibration and air-pump suction. App-controlled, long-distance compatible (pair with a partner’s Lovense product for synchronised mutual control). Mid-tier price point.

The Arcwave Range

Arcwave is We-Vibe’s male sub-brand (We-Vibe is owned by WOW Tech). Smaller catalogue than Kiiroo or Lovense, but distinctively different sensation.

Arcwave Ion

The flagship and the only device of its kind on the market. Uses pleasure-air / suction technology — the same format that revolutionised clitoral toys with Satisfyer and Womanizer — applied to the frenulum (the underside of the penis head).

The sensation is genuinely different from any other male toy: pulsing air-pressure waves against the frenulum, no stroking motion, no traditional vibration. Reviewers consistently describe it as “feels like nothing else, takes a few sessions to understand, then becomes a favourite.”

If you want a completely different category of sensation from stroking-based toys: Arcwave Ion is the product.

Arcwave Voy

Adjustable manual stroker. Patented tightness adjustment via external rings — you can dial the grip from gentle to intense. Not motorised; you do the stroking. Premium silicone construction.

Arcwave Pow

Mid-tier manual stroker with end-piece pressure adjustment. Similar concept to Voy but at a lower price point.

How to Use a Premium Automatic Stroker

  1. Charge fully before first use. 2–4 hours initial charge.
  2. Apply water-based lube generously to both the sleeve and yourself. Silicone lube degrades silicone and TPE sleeves over time.
  3. Position the device on a stable surface or use the included stand. Most premium auto-strokers are designed to sit between your legs while you’re reclined.
  4. Slide in slowly and let the stroke pattern start at a low speed before adjusting upward. Premium strokers are powerful — starting at full intensity is overwhelming.
  5. Pair the app before the session, not during. Bluetooth pairing mid-arousal is the opposite of seamless. Set up content syncing or partner control beforehand.
  6. Session limits. Most devices can run 60–120 minutes per charge but the comfort limit is 20–40 minutes. Take breaks.
  7. For heated devices: let the sleeve come up to temperature before insertion. Adds 2–5 minutes to startup.

Care and Cleaning — Critical for Premium Devices

Premium automatic strokers have one rule that matters more than any other: only the removable sleeve goes under water. The motor housing must never be submerged or rinsed.

For the sleeve: rinse with warm water immediately after use, wash with mild soap or dedicated toy cleaner, rinse, pat dry, air-dry fully (invert if possible). For TPE sleeves, dust with cornstarch after drying to maintain the silky finish.

For the motor housing: wipe with a slightly damp cloth. That’s it. Charge between uses, not just before, to extend battery lifespan.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the best automatic male masturbator in 2026?
Kiiroo Keon for interactive content sync and sleeve options. Lovense Solace Pro for battery life and thrust strength. Arcwave Ion for completely different (pleasure-air) sensation. No universal best — they target different use cases.

Is the Kiiroo Keon worth the money?
If you want interactive content syncing or long-distance partner play, yes — it’s the global flagship for a reason. If you just want hands-free stroking without those features, a cheaper non-app-paired auto-stroker (Zolo Lift Off, MASTURS Solara) covers the same use case.

Do I need an app to use a Kiiroo Keon?
No — the Keon works in manual mode with side buttons. The FeelConnect app adds interactive content syncing, custom patterns and long-distance partner control. Manual mode covers solo basics.

What’s the difference between Kiiroo Keon and Lovense Solace Pro?
Keon strokes (mechanical motion of the sleeve up and down the penis). Solace Pro thrusts (more pronounced in-and-out motion). Keon has more sleeve options and more mature AI content sync; Solace Pro has longer battery life and built-in screen controls. Different motion types, different ecosystems, same premium tier.

What is the Arcwave Ion?
A male sex toy that uses pleasure-air technology (pulsing suction waves) applied to the frenulum. Same format as Satisfyer clitoral toys but targeted at male anatomy. Produces a sensation completely different from any stroker — some users love it, some don’t. Worth trying if you want something genuinely different.

Can I use a Kiiroo Keon with VR porn?
Yes — the Keon syncs with interactive VR content via FeelConnect. Combined with a VR headset, it creates a coordinated experience. Setup involves pairing the Keon, the headset and the content source through FeelConnect.

How loud are automatic strokers?
Not silent. Mechanical thrusting and suction motors produce some noise. Most premium devices (Kiiroo, Lovense, Fun Factory) are noticeably quieter than budget alternatives but still audible in a quiet room. Music or TV background covers the sound. Not the right product if total acoustic discretion is essential.

Do these work for long-distance couples?
Yes — Kiiroo Keon (via FeelConnect) and Lovense Solace Pro (via Lovense Remote) both support partner-controlled long-distance use. Your partner controls the device from anywhere with internet, and synchronisation with their toy is possible on both ecosystems.

What lube should I use?
Water-based only. Silicone lube degrades silicone and TPE sleeves. Most manufacturers sell their own lube (Kiiroo, Lovense), or any quality water-based lube from our lubricants collection works fine.

How long do these devices last?
Motor / housing: 3–7 years with proper care, depending on usage frequency. Sleeves: 50–200+ uses each, then replace (Kiiroo, Lovense and most premium brands sell replacement sleeves separately). Battery: lithium batteries gradually lose capacity — typically 300–500 charge cycles before noticeable degradation.
